RARE monograph on two important religious minorities in the history of the island of Chios, Jews and Catholics, studied against the background of Orthodox Greek religion and the administrations of the successive Byzantine, Genoese and Turkish masters. Contains extensive appendices with documents related to the history of both Jews and Catholics in the island: some of the documents pertaining to Jews are published in the original Latin, other documents are translated from the original Hebrew into English, the tombstone inscriptions are in both the original Hebrew with English translation, and the documents pertaining to Catholics are all in the original Latin. 230x145mm.
